Aaron Jones c4acd427ac
MbedTLS: Misc backend cleanups
This is a forward-port of release/3.5 commit 566f4678

* Add generic direction enum for negotiation setup.

* Rename a rather long wrapper function to a shorter one consistent with
  what it does.

* Rework context setup function.

* Don't check for handshake state before beginning handshaking.

  The old backend began a handshake and then stepped into the callback
  function if it was interrupted; the current one just jumps right into
  it, so there is no need to check if it has previously succeeded,
  because it hasn't been attempted yet.

* Add missing errno assignment to one of the handshake wrappers.

* Don't bother checking if SSL_P(F) is NULL when we already checked if
  F->ssl is NULL -- this should be impossible.

* Don't bother checking if SSL_C(F) is NULL -- this was a no-op.

* Change the socket send and recv functions to not peer into a foreign
  ratbox structure -- use the correct function to get the socket fd.

* Rewrap some lines and function arguments.

Other backends will be brought into line with this backend soon.

This will enable easier maintenance of the backends, by reducing the
diffs between them, which should make different behaviour easier to
spot.

Aaron Jones 73c486c7a5
MbedTLS: Treat 0 bytes read/written to socket properly
At the moment, if a link quits in just the right (wrong [1]) way,
the quit reason will resemble:

    <-- foo (~bar@baz) has quit (Read error: (-0x0) )

This should resolve that.

[1] Peers should send a close_notify alert before abruptly shutting
    down their socket. This will result in a sane quit message:

    <-- foo (~bar@baz) has quit (Read error: (-0x7880) SSL -
    The peer notified us that the connection is going to be closed)

Aaron Jones 572c2d4b05
OpenSSL: Initialise one context at a time
If initialising the server context fails, but the client one succeeds,
we will not only leak memory, but the error message reported for
initialising the server context might not make sense, because we
initialise the client context after and that could erase or change the
list of queued errors.

This scenario is considered rare. Nevertheless, we now initialise the
client context after *successfully* initialising the server context.
